Suzuki Hayabusa 1300: Suzuki Hayabusa is the beast and has an amazing speed of 188 to 194 miles per hour which comes to 303 to 312 km/h. However, anyone wanting to take this beast home has to cough up a whopping INR 12,50,000/-. The bike is powered by 1340CC engine, with disc brakes, alloy wheels, DOHC liquid cooled engine with 16 valves and twin swirl combustion chambers.




Yamaha YZF R15: Yamaha R15 is designed for Indian roads and its India’s first liquid cooled 150CC engine It looks awesome and can clock a top speed of 135kmph. It has 6 speed transmission, electric start, tubeless tyres and a fuel capacity of 12liters.





TVS Apache RTR 180: TVS Apache 180 takes whole segment of the sports bike to another level with powerful performance, control, stability, acceleration and ride handling that it provides It comes with 5 speed gear transmission, can touch highest speed of 125kmph and provides solid safety of disc brakes. This bike is priced at INR 64,000/- for Indian buyers.



Hero Honda Karizma R: Hero Honda Karizma is the 223CC bike which clocks a top speed of 125kmph. The powerful engine can race from 0 to 60km in just 4.4seconds. This bike has 5 speed gear transmission, hydraulic shock absorber and fuel tank capacity of 15 liters. This bike can be yours at around Rs.1 lakh.

Car fluid and fuel maintenance tips

• The car fluid must be changed on time
• The anti freeze fluid and the brake fluid must be changed after every 30000 miles
• Change the regular oil after every 3,000 miles and synthetic oil after every 5000 miles.
• The air filter must be changed after every 12,000 miles or 12 months whichever comes first
• The fuel filter must be changed after every 24,000 miles or 2 years whichever comes first
• The transmission fluid must be changed after every 30,000 miles
• There must be a schedule maintenance check after every 30,000 miles

Car tire maintenance tips
• The car tires must be changed after every 5,000 miles or 6 months whichever comes first. If the tread is worn out by 1/16 inch the tires must be changed.
• The wheels must be aligned properly so that the car drives smoothly on the road and not get dragged
• You must check the tire pressure at least once a week. If there is less pressure in the tire it will affect the fuel efficiency and may give some discomfort as well. Always check the pressure of the tire when it is cold i.e. three hours after a drive
• You must also check the spare tire every week so that it is in top maintained condition in situation when you will need it the most.
